更新时间:2024-04-26 gmt 08:00
oauth获取用户信息-j9九游会登录
用于web端oauth登录认证场景,saas服务器换取用户token后,根据用户token获取用户基础信息。
uri
get /api/v1/oauth2/userinfo
请求参数
|
参数 |
是否必选 |
参数类型 |
描述 |
|---|---|---|---|
|
accept |
是 |
string |
接收响应类型,值:application/json。 |
|
authorization |
是 |
string |
认证凭据,值:bearer {access_token}。 |
请求示例
get {domain_name}/api/v1/oauth2/userinfo
authorization: bearer ******
accept: application/json
响应参数
|
状态码 |
描述 |
|---|---|
|
200 |
请求成功。 |
|
401 |
认证失败。 |
|
参数 |
参数类型 |
描述 |
|---|---|---|
|
id |
string |
用户id |
|
username |
string |
用户名 |
|
name |
string |
姓名 |
|
|
string |
邮箱地址 |
|
mobile |
string |
手机号 |
|
error |
string |
错误类型。 |
|
error_description |
string |
错误描述。 |
|
role |
string |
角色 |
|
organizationname |
string |
组织名称 |
|
userid |
string |
用户id |
|
organizationcode |
string |
组织编码 |
|
projectname |
string |
租户名称 |
|
tenant |
string |
租户id |
响应示例
状态码:200
请求成功。
{
"id" : "20201029190841785-cb37-8bd36b...",
"name" : "test",
"username" : "test",
"mobile" : "12345678901",
"email" : "123@example.com"
}
状态码:401
认证失败。
{
"error" : "unauthorized",
"error_description" : "full authentication is required to access this resource"
}
父主题:
相关文档
意见反馈
文档内容是否对您有帮助?
提交成功!非常感谢您的反馈,我们会继续努力做到更好!
您可在查看反馈及问题处理状态。
系统繁忙,请稍后重试
如您有其它疑问,您也可以通过华为云社区问答频道来与我们联系探讨